The "worst" RCP8.5 / SSP5-8.5-style futures (coal-dominated, ~4.4–4.9 °C) are no longer treated as plausible given policy already in place, renewable cost declines, and observed emissions.
The policy changes have changed the projections.
Warming will continue, yes. The consequences will have to be dealt with. In some regions this will be problematic. It's still political and economical factors that determines the outcome.
